Description:

According to Alec McDonald, Laura Hayes is 'impertinent, impulsive, insubordinate and totally lacking in self-discipline' - all negatives in an employee. Mind you, he also has to admit that she has the legs of a Las Vegas showgirl. According to Laura Hayes, Alec McDonald is 'a pompous bigot who considers hankies standard issue for his female employees.' But while these are negatives in a boss, Laura doesn't intend to remain his employee for long. Within twenty-four hours of their first meeting, Laura and Alec are partners. Equal Partners. Yet wo bosses is one too many for any business - especially when the boss is falling in love with the boss. (And his six-year-old son!)
